Plant growth chambers are used to create artificial environments, with controlled humidity, light, temperature and atmospheric gas composition, for cultivating and examining the growth of plants. These chambers are generally made using metals and covered in a white enamel finish.

They comprise sensors, touchscreen controls, observation windows, additional lighting, spray nozzle packages, alarms and glass doors, which enable users to regulate the conditions as per their requirement. They are widely utilized in research and development (R&D) projects to determine the effects of specific biotic or abiotic parameters during the life cycle of plants, thereby helping researchers understand their productivity.

Rapid urbanization, rising population and declining arable land are leading to increasing food security concerns around the world. This represents one of the key factors catalyzing the demand for plant growth chambers as they enhance the productivity of the agricultural land. These chambers are utilized in horticulture crop production and provide consistent crop quality, increased productivity, flexibility in changing plant location and thus an efficient usage of the space. Apart from this, these chambers are also used for agricultural and botanical research, which is further augmenting the market growth.

Furthermore, advancements in biological engineering, along with the growing adoption of genetically modified crops, is also contributing to the market growth. Moreover, the increasing popularity of plant growth chambers in dry climatic regions that are more susceptible to drought conditions is also driving the growth of the market.

Furthermore, increasing investments in R&D activities, coupled with the introduction of cost-efficient variants, are expected to drive the market in the coming years.
